Banking & payments for Software Development Agency
Opening a traditional bank account for a BVI company is challenging and slow (3-12 weeks), often requiring extensive KYC and sometimes an in-person visit. However, remote onboarding is highly feasible through EMIs and fintechs like Airwallex, Payoneer, and Aspire, provided the company has clear documentation and a low-risk business model.

Restricted Purpose Company formation steps
Engage a licensed BVI Registered Agent (mandatory for all BVI entities).
Select a company name ending with the mandatory suffix '(SPV) Limited' or '(SPV) Ltd'.
Draft a highly specific Memorandum of Association detailing the exact restricted purposes of the company.
Complete rigorous KYC/AML checks for all directors, shareholders, and ultimate beneficial owners (UBOs).
Submit the incorporation documents and pay the $7,500 government registration fee to the BVI Financial Services Commission (FSC).
Receive the Certificate of Incorporation and stamped Memorandum and Articles of Association (typically within 2-5 days).
Appoint the initial directors, issue shares, and file the beneficial ownership information into the BVI BOSS system.
Software Development Agency FAQ
Where is the best place to incorporate a dev agency?
Estonia is great for reinvesting profits without immediate tax, while a US LLC (Wyoming or Delaware) is excellent for global invoicing and accessing US clients.
How do withholding taxes affect my agency?
If your client's country doesn't have a tax treaty with your company's jurisdiction, they might be required by their local laws to withhold a percentage of your invoice amount.
Do I need to charge VAT or GST to my clients?
It depends on the location of your clients. B2B software services exported outside your jurisdiction are often zero-rated, but you must verify local reverse-charge rules.
